SEXUALITY AND RELATIONSHIPS: THE EMOTIONAL TRANSFORMATION WHEN FAITH BECOMES A PRACTICE OF SELFLOVE

Faith is a powerful force that can transform an individual's life for the better. It has been shown to have numerous benefits such as increased happiness, reduced stress, improved physical health, and greater overall well-being.

There are different ways in which people approach their faith. Some view it as an obligation they must follow out of fear of punishment while others see it as a way to connect with a higher power. But what happens when faith becomes a practice of self-love rather than obedience? This article will explore how emotional transformations occur when faith is practiced this way.

When faith is used as a tool to build self-esteem and create positive changes in one's life, it can be a source of great joy and fulfillment. It allows individuals to focus on themselves and find acceptance from within instead of seeking approval from external sources. This shift in perspective leads to more confidence, compassion, empathy, and understanding towards oneself and others. People who practice faith in this manner are able to let go of guilt, shame, and regret, allowing them to feel free and open to new experiences. They become more aware of their strengths and weaknesses, leading to self-discovery and growth.

Self-love is an important aspect of personal development that involves accepting oneself unconditionally. By incorporating faith into self-love practices, individuals can experience profound changes in their emotions. The act of forgiving oneself becomes easier, allowing for healing and releasing old wounds. It also promotes resilience, making it possible to bounce back from setbacks quickly and move forward without being held back by negative thoughts or feelings. Faith provides support during challenging times, giving individuals the courage to face adversity head-on.

When faith is used as a practice of self-love, it creates meaningful connections with others. Individuals who have accepted and embraced their authentic selves are better equipped to connect with those around them. They are less likely to judge others based on their own beliefs or values, allowing for greater empathy and understanding. They also see opportunities for growth in every interaction, helping them build stronger relationships over time.

Practicing faith as a tool for self-love has numerous benefits both mentally and emotionally. It allows individuals to find acceptance within themselves, promote personal growth, and create meaningful connections with others. While there is no one right way to approach faith, it's clear that this method leads to powerful transformations in an individual's life.
